Tidaholm between industrial history and river landscapes
The Tidaholm Museum is located in the former factory premises of Vulcan's industry on Vulcanön and tells how Tidaholm developed as an industrial town. The permanent exhibition explains how the Vulcan match factory and industrialization shaped the town.
Industry and culture
Vulcan's old smithy has been preserved as a living industrial monument. Food, tools and work surfaces illustrate the working environment around 1900; smithing courses are also held in the smithy. Another exhibition venue is Tidaholms konsthall, housed in a former turbine building constructed on the Tidan River in 1898. It presents changing art exhibitions in spring, summer and autumn.
In the museum's C-Magasin, the exhibition “Tidaholms bruks bilar” displays nine preserved vehicles. On Turbinhusön, the Museistugan conveys what life was like in the 18th and 19th centuries through several smithies furnished in period style. The smithies can be visited in summer.
River landscapes
The Tidan River runs through Tidaholm, and most of the town's central parks are located along the river. Turbinhusön is a preserved cultural landscape on the banks of the Tidan in central Tidaholm and has a long riverside promenade. The Strandpromenaden runs between Östra Drottningvägen and the Tidan River; tall trees, lawns and plantings characterize this section.
At Bruksvilleparken, you can walk along the Tidan, take a coffee break and use the barbecue area with tables and seating. In summer, there is entertainment on the outdoor stage. Fishing is also possible in the Tidan in central Tidaholm, for which a fishing permit is required. On Turbinhusön, Handelsboden offers locally produced products and local handicrafts in summer.
Activities
Aktivitetsrundan on Hellidsberget is a 2.5-kilometre exercise trail with twelve signs and exercises for children and adults. The trails on Hellidsberget are prepared for cross-country skiing in winter. There is also an easy, 10-kilometre circular mountain bike trail, beginning at the trail centre by SISU-stugan.
Norra Rundan passes through forest landscapes, open fields and grazing land and offers diverse wildlife, including grazing cows and rare bird species.
Town trails and visitor information
Stadsvandring in Tidaholm is a historical walking tour through the town's stories, buildings and places. It visits stations of cultural and historical interest, including Turbinhusön. Visit Tidaholm is centrally located on Vulcanön and can be reached on foot. It provides information about nature experiences, local culture, events and practical details for visitors.

Connections
Västtrafik line 302 connects Tidaholm and Falköping. Line 303 connects Tidaholm and Skövde.
